Output 597756fea2371eefe9c8c25064b326a9a60ad094da29eec243ff12c68abf5c5c:6
- value
- 107266
- script pubkey
- OP_0 OP_PUSHBYTES_20 8abdc758e7780e31442fac46ea519053a1cbdf97
- address
- bc1q327uwk880q8rz3p043rw55vs2wsuhhuhl6ew8u
- transaction
- 597756fea2371eefe9c8c25064b326a9a60ad094da29eec243ff12c68abf5c5c